WIPO logo
Mobile | Deutsch | Español | Français | 日本語 | 한국어 | Português | Русский | 中文 | العربية |
PATENTSCOPE

Search International and National Patent Collections
World Intellectual Property Organization
Search
 
Browse
 
Translate
 
Options
 
News
 
Login
 
Help
 
Machine translation
1. (WO2018031601) LOCALIZING NETWORK FAULTS THROUGH DIFFERENTIAL ANALYSIS OF TCP TELEMETRY
Latest bibliographic data on file with the International Bureau    Submit observation

Pub. No.: WO/2018/031601 International Application No.: PCT/US2017/045997
Publication Date: 15.02.2018 International Filing Date: 09.08.2017
IPC:
H04L 12/26 (2006.01)
Applicants: MICROSOFT TECHNOLOGY LICENSING, LLC[US/US]; One Microsoft Way Redmond, Washington 98052-6399, US
Inventors: OUTHRED, Geoff; US
CIRACI, Selim; US
Agent: MINHAS, Sandip S.; US
CHEN, Wei-Chen Nicholas; US
DRAKOS, Katherine J.; US
HINOJOSA, Brianna L.; US
HOLMES, Danielle J.; US
SWAIN, Cassandra T.; US
WONG, Thomas S.; US
CHOI, Daniel; US
HWANG, William C.; US
WIGHT, Stephen A.; US
CHATTERJEE, Aaron C.; US
Priority Data:
15/235,37512.08.2016US
Title (EN) LOCALIZING NETWORK FAULTS THROUGH DIFFERENTIAL ANALYSIS OF TCP TELEMETRY
(FR) LOCALISATION DE DÉFAILLANCES DU RÉSEAU VIA L'ANALYSE DIFFÉRENTIELLE D'UNE TÉLÉMESURE TCP
Abstract: front page image
(EN) A server includes a processor and memory. An operating system is executed by the processor and memory. A network interface is run by the operating system and sends and receives flows using transmission control protocol (TCP). An agent application is run by the operating system and is configured to a) retrieve and store TCP telemetry data for the flows in a flow table; b) move selected ones of the flows from the flow table to a closed connections table when the flow is closed; and c) periodically send the flow table and the closed connections table via the network interface to a remote server.
(FR) Selon l'invention, un serveur comprend un processeur et une mémoire. Un système d'exploitation est exécuté par le processeur et la mémoire. Une interface réseau est exécutée par le système d'exploitation, et envoie et reçoit des flux selon un protocole de commande de transmission (TCP). Une application agent est exécutée par le système d'exploitation. Elle est configurée pour : a) récupérer et stocker des données de télémesure TCP pour les flux d'une table de flux ; b) déplacer des flux sélectionnés parmi les flux, de la table de flux à une table de connexions fermées lorsque le flux est fermé ; et c) envoyer périodiquement la table de flux et la table de connexions fermées à un serveur distant, via l'interface réseau.
Designated States: AE, AG, AL, AM, AO, AT, AU, AZ, BA, BB, BG, BH, BN, BR, BW, BY, BZ, CA, CH, CL, CN, CO, CR, CU, CZ, DE, DJ, DK, DM, DO, DZ, EC, EE, EG, ES, FI, GB, GD, GE, GH, GM, GT, HN, HR, HU, ID, IL, IN, IR, IS, JO, JP, KE, KG, KH, KN, KP, KR, KW, KZ, LA, LC, LK, LR, LS, LU, LY, MA, MD, ME, MG, MK, MN, MW, MX, MY, MZ, NA, NG, NI, NO, NZ, OM, PA, PE, PG, PH, PL, PT, QA, RO, RS, RU, RW, SA, SC, SD, SE, SG, SK, SL, SM, ST, SV, SY, TH, TJ, TM, TN, TR, TT, TZ, UA, UG, US, UZ, VC, VN, ZA, ZM, ZW
African Regional Intellectual Property Organization (ARIPO) (BW, GH, GM, KE, LR, LS, MW, MZ, NA, RW, SD, SL, ST, SZ, TZ, UG, ZM, ZW)
Eurasian Patent Office (AM, AZ, BY, KG, KZ, RU, TJ, TM)
European Patent Office (EPO) (AL, AT, BE, BG, CH, CY, CZ, DE, DK, EE, ES, FI, FR, GB, GR, HR, HU, IE, IS, IT, LT, LU, LV, MC, MK, MT, NL, NO, PL, PT, RO, RS, SE, SI, SK, SM, TR)
African Intellectual Property Organization (BF, BJ, CF, CG, CI, CM, GA, GN, GQ, GW, KM, ML, MR, NE, SN, TD, TG)
Publication Language: English (EN)
Filing Language: English (EN)